Web20 aug. 2024 · The boundary wire runs once around the entire working area of a robotic mower, starting and ending at the charging station. This sends a weak current through the cable, which creates a magnetic field. The robotic mower can detect this weak field with special sensors. This can melt the … companies that shred personal papersWebA Bad Boy zero-turn lawn mower will not start when it is not getting air, fuel, and spark. This is often caused by a plugged air filter, bad fuel, dirty carburetor, plugged fuel components, bad spark plug, faulty electrical components, or bad battery.
